New Method to Reduce Scoring Bias in LLM-as-a-Judge Evaluators

ai-technology · 2026-08-10

A research paper on arXiv (2608.05726) proposes a novel method to mitigate scoring bias in Large Language Models (LLMs) used as evaluators of text quality, a practice known as LLM-as-a-Judge. The method involves instructing the LLM to randomly generate number tokens, then measuring the deviation of the observed distribution from a uniform distribution to identify latent numerical bias. Task-specific bias is measured by adding a definition of the downstream task to the random number generation prompts. During evaluation, token generation probabilities are rectified to account for this bias. Experiments were conducted on four tasks, though details are not provided in the abstract.
